Murgawan Population - Jehanabad, Bihar
Murgawan is a large village located in Hulasganj Block of Jehanabad district, Bihar with total 984 families residing. The Murgawan village has population of 6004 of which 3163 are males while 2841 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Murgawan village population of children with age 0-6 is 875 which makes up 14.57 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Murgawan village is 898 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Murgawan as per census is 927, lower than Bihar average of 935.
Murgawan village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Murgawan village was 71.61 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Murgawan Male literacy stands at 80.29 % while female literacy rate was 61.90 %.

Murgawan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 984 | - | - |
Population | 6,004 | 3,163 | 2,841 |
Child (0-6) | 875 | 454 | 421 |
Schedule Caste | 609 | 305 | 304 |
Schedule Tribe | 6 | 4 | 2 |
Literacy | 71.61 % | 80.29 % | 61.90 % |
Total Workers | 2,351 | 1,547 | 804 |
Main Worker | 1,948 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 403 | 277 | 126 |
